Transaction 98169038d95cd463eccff3b43782b4db6ff4fb50fc1fe6e5519294673dcf6667

2 Input
2 Outputs
  • 98169038d95cd463eccff3b43782b4db6ff4fb50fc1fe6e5519294673dcf6667:0
  • value  22345173
    address  16DQUcYViqpRCFpwp36YFGHEkUN2Dm6hn8
  • 98169038d95cd463eccff3b43782b4db6ff4fb50fc1fe6e5519294673dcf6667:1
  • value  19996
    address  1K3tuTvtMtEfpgf4mxDsDXNUyWVZ3VVh93